TearLab Corporation Reports Q1-15 Financial Results 

 

San Diego, CA —May 7, 2015— TearLab Corporation (NASDAQ:TEAR; TSX:TLB) (“TearLab” or the “Company”) today reported its consolidated financial results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2015. All dollar amounts are expressed in U.S. currency and results are reported in accordance with United States generally accepted accounting principles.

 

For the three months ended March 31, 2015, TearLab’s net revenues were $5.4 million, up 28% from $4.2 million for the same period in 2014. A total of 261 orders for TearLab systems were booked in the first quarter, of which 213 were under the Company’s new Flex program, 34 were under the Company's Masters Multi Unit Program, minimum use access programs decreased by 11, there were no direct purchases and 25 were purchased outside of the U.S. The Company’s net loss for the three months ended March 31, 2015 was approximately $8.2 million, or $0.24 per share on a non-diluted basis. This included approximately $0.1 million in non-cash income related to the revaluation of warrants issued in June 2011. The Company’s net loss for the 2014 first quarter was $5.6 million, or $0.17 per share on a non-diluted basis. This included approximately $0.3 million in non-cash income related to the revaluation of warrants issued in June 2011.

As of March 31, 2015, TearLab had $23.3 million in cash and cash equivalents.

 

“We started 2015 with a fully staffed sales force, a better understanding of implementation, and, as evidenced by the continuing growth of our installed base and the success of our Flex program, the ability to focus simultaneously on new accounts and utilization again,” commented Elias Vamvakas, TearLab’s Chief Executive Officer. “Moving into Q2, we had a strong showing at ASCRS in San Diego, with a successful sales effort on the floor of the meeting and a number of papers and discussions supporting our messaging to doctors that hyperosmolarity undermines visual outcomes.”

About TearLab Corporation

 

TearLab Corporation (www.tearlab.com) develops and markets lab-on-a-chip technologies that enable eye care practitioners to improve standard of care by objectively and quantitatively testing for disease markers in tears at the point-of-care. The TearLab Osmolarity® Test, for diagnosing Dry Eye Disease, is the first assay developed for the award-winning TearLab Osmolarity System. Headquartered in San Diego, CA, TearLab Corporation's common shares trade on the NASDAQ Capital Market under the symbol 'TEAR' and on the Toronto Stock Exchange under the symbol 'TLB'.
